ITC Finds Injury From Chinese Steel Fencing Imports, Moves to Final Investigation Phase
March 06, 2025
WASHINGTON, March 6 (TNSFR) -- The U.S. International Trade Commission has determined that an industry in the United States is suffering material injury due to imports of temporary steel fencing from China that are allegedly subsidized and sold at less than fair value.
